Some basic care info in Ford videos
Here is some basic info on caring for your 6.0L truck.
<TABLE style="WIDTH: 262pt; BORDER-COLLAPSE: collapse" border=0 cellSpacing=0 cellPadding=0 width=350 x:str><COLGROUP><COL style="WIDTH: 262pt; mso-width-source: userset; mso-width-alt: 12352" width=350><TBODY><TR style="HEIGHT: 25.85pt" height=34><TD style="BORDER-BOTTOM: #d4d0c8; BORDER-LEFT: #d4d0c8; BACKGROUND-COLOR: transparent; WIDTH: 262pt; HEIGHT: 25.85pt; BORDER-TOP: #d4d0c8; BORDER-RIGHT: #d4d0c8" class=xl24 height=34 width=350>http://www.motorcraftservice.com/vdirs/servicetips/dieselcare/index.html</TD></TR></TBODY></TABLE>
Click on the 6.0L label and watch the "lead-in" video until the end (or click on the "right arrow" to take you to the end). At that point, you will have a menu of things to choose from.
One item to note is the oil information. When you click on it, you will see an oil application chart about 30 seconds into the video. In that chart you can see what Ford has to tell us about the 5W40 temperature "range of application". It says -20*F to over 100*F. This was a question awhile back (ie whether or not Ford actually acknowledged the use of 5W40 in this wide of a range).

I know the 15W goes a little farther right than the 5W. I don't know why, and it doesn't make sense to me. They are both 40 weight base stocks, and it's well known that synthetic withstands heat better than conventional. I can't guess why they slanted the chart toward 15W like they did.
Multi-weight oils use hydrocarbon-polymer chemistry to "stretch" the base weight to the second weight. And with all other things being equal, a 15-weight oil performs better in high temperatures than a 0-weight or 5-weight oil.
Now, given that synthetics (supposedly) perform better than conventional oils, some of this is no longer current. (i.e. things are not equal).
But what I was told, way back when, was that older 10w40 oils were poor oils to use because the (then) current base oils weren't of sufficient quality to be "stretched" to a 40-weight oil. That's probably why 20w50 oils had some brief popularity in automotive engines in the late '80's and 90's.
These days, better quality base stocks allow 15-weight oil to be "stretched" with little difficulty. And synthetics allow 5-weight group-IV (the latest group?) base stocks to be stretched without harm. But in super-high-heat applications (such as in the American Southwest (AZ, NM, SoTX, SoCA), where daytime ambient temps in summer can exceed 120 degrees), a 15-weight base stock oil will probably perform better in most scenarios, especially those where the truck's owner is somewhat less than OCD on maintenance.
